SUMMARY

The discussion centers on the definition and significance of pulse current discharge tests in lithium-ion batteries. A pulse current discharge test evaluates the battery's performance under short bursts of high current, which is critical for applications like electric vehicles. The referenced article by Huria et al. (2012) provides a comprehensive model for characterizing and simulating high power lithium battery cells, emphasizing the importance of thermal dependence in these tests.
